Whaling Wall, BundabergBundaberg is a progressive city surrounded by a patchwork of sugarcane fields. It has a wide deep river and is popular as an Australian first port of entry for sea faring travellers. Bundaberg is an ideal holiday centre with excellent holiday accommodation, attractions and entertainment. Coastal resorts provide excellent seaside holidays. For visitors eager to explore the wondrous Great Barrier Reef, day trips and overnight stays to the reef leave from Bundaberg. It is a sports minded city and has produced many world class athletes. Bundaberg features an easy going lifestyle, with its climatic position making it the fifth equable climate in the world.

Witness turtles hatching

Witness turtles hatching

Mon Repos Beach hosts the world's largest loggerhead turtle mainland nesting site. Enjoy the Coral Coast Turtle festival that celebrates the start of nesting season each November, or tune in later to watch baby turtles hatch and clamber over the sands.  more
